Advanced Leadership Course: Theory and Practice

GOAL AND CONTENT

The course aims to provide participants with theoretical and practical tools for an in-depth understanding of the principles of effective leadership fundamental for managing complex situations and developing negotiation skills in international contexts. Ethical leadership and a positive and supportive work environment positively influence the performance of collaborators and the achievement of common objectives in line with the fundamental values ​​of an organization.

Applying the principles of assertive and persuasive communication, emotional intelligence, time management, problem solving and enhancing collaboration and cooperation skills, resilience and mental agility and creativity means strengthening the fundamental soft and power skills in any field of work.

The program will also offer participants an understanding of how the different value systems of individuals, societies and cultures influence the values ​​and culture within organizations, especially today in a globalized and multicultural world.

PROGRAMME

The program is structured by providing interactive teaching and workshops in which case studies of historical leaders in various international contexts will be examined.

Reading Materials to read in conjunction with lessons: Leadership Portraits from Caesar to Modern Times: Why These Leaders Matter Today (2023).

Course Structure:

1. Leadership theories and models: Learning to manage ourselves.
2. Types of leadership: analysis and historical comparisons.
3. Modern leaders of the past: The Caesars
– Mark Antony’s speech from Shakespeare’s “Julius Caesar”.
4. The soft skills of the Leader and the development of a strategic vision: Napoleon Bonaparte.
5. The Evolution of Leadership Throughout History: Why Is Lincoln Still Relevant Today?
6. Creative thinking, example, inspiration, the Leader decides: Martin Luther King
7. Negotiation and Conflict Management: Franklin Delano Roosevelt the Transformative Leader.
8. Resilience and empathy in Leadership: the example of Anna Eleanor Roosevelt, Golda Meir, Angela Merkel, Giorgia Meloni
9. Margaret Thatcher: an iron Leader
10. Oprah Winfrey: a charismatic and visionary leader
11. Common Denominators of Great Leadership

The lessons will be held by Prof. Emilio Iodice, Director Emeritus, Professor of Leadership, Loyola University of Chicago, Diplomat and Advisor to US Administrations, with the integration of authoritative testimonies representative of modern Leadership.
